首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

hibernate搜索中使用任意搜索词和合作id查询合作成员

Hibernate Search是一个全文搜索引擎库,它集成了Hibernate和Apache Lucene,用于在关系型数据库中进行全文搜索。它通过将数据存储在数据库中,并使用Lucene进行搜索和索引,实现高效的全文搜索功能。

Hibernate Search可以在合作成员表中使用任意搜索词和合作ID查询合作成员。以下是一个完善且全面的答案:

概念: Hibernate Search是一个开源的全文搜索引擎库,它基于Hibernate和Apache Lucene。它允许在关系型数据库中进行全文搜索,并提供了高效的搜索和索引功能。

分类: Hibernate Search可以被分类为全文搜索引擎、数据库工具、Java持久化解决方案。

优势:

  • 简化全文搜索:Hibernate Search通过将数据存储在数据库中,并使用Lucene进行搜索和索引,提供了简单而强大的全文搜索功能。
  • 高效的搜索性能:Hibernate Search的基础是Apache Lucene,它是一个高性能的全文搜索引擎。通过利用Lucene的优势,Hibernate Search可以实现快速而准确的搜索结果。
  • 简化的集成:Hibernate Search与Hibernate框架集成紧密,可以方便地与现有的Hibernate应用程序集成,无需大量的代码修改。
  • 支持各种搜索功能:Hibernate Search支持多种搜索功能,包括全文搜索、模糊搜索、通配符搜索、范围搜索等。这使得开发人员可以根据实际需求实现灵活的搜索功能。

应用场景: Hibernate Search适用于各种场景,包括但不限于以下几种:

  • 电子商务平台:用于在商品数据库中实现快速搜索和过滤功能,提供更好的用户体验。
  • 社交媒体应用程序:用于在用户数据库中实现快速搜索和推荐功能,提高用户交互性。
  • 内容管理系统:用于在文章数据库中实现全文搜索和关键词高亮显示等功能,提供更好的内容检索体验。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多种云计算相关产品,以下是一些推荐的产品和其介绍链接地址,用于支持使用Hibernate Search的应用程序:

  1. 云数据库MySQL:提供高性能、可靠的MySQL数据库服务,可用于存储合作成员数据。
    • 产品介绍链接:https://cloud.tencent.com/product/cdb
  • 云服务器CVM:提供可扩展的虚拟云服务器,适用于部署和运行应用程序。
    • 产品介绍链接:https://cloud.tencent.com/product/cvm
  • 云对象存储COS:提供安全可靠的对象存储服务,可用于存储应用程序中的大型文件和多媒体数据。
    • 产品介绍链接:https://cloud.tencent.com/product/cos
  • 云安全中心:提供全面的云安全解决方案,包括DDoS攻击防护、数据加密等。
    • 产品介绍链接:https://cloud.tencent.com/product/ddos

请注意,以上仅为示例,实际使用时应根据具体需求选择适合的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券